Results of 2006 Objectives:

  1. The Committee maintained constructive communication and a positive working relationship with the AOIC.  Representatives from AOIC attended Committee meetings on a regular basis and energetically participated in the Committee’s works-in-progress.
  1. With the assistance of AOIC, the Committee completed work on the first statewide pretrial-services survey.  Besides providing a statistical description of pretrial services programs operating in Illinois, the survey identified pretrial-related training needs.  In addition, the survey provided the necessary information for the creation and publication of the State of Illinois Pretrial Services Directory. 
  1. The Committee strongly advocated for IPCSA’s continued affiliation with the National Association of Pretrial Services Agencies (NAPSA).  The Committee requested in their 2006 budget funding to cover expenses for two Committee members to attend this important conference and training event.  Unfortunately, financial appropriations could not be rendered. 
  1. The Committee’s first newsletter was published.  The intent of the newsletter is to disseminate pretrial “news,” encourage communication and networking among Illinois’ pretrial practitioners, and support program development. 

Summary of Objectives for 2007.

  1. Generate and promote the participation and involvement of pretrial practitioners at IPCSA Conferences and Committee meetings.
  1. Strongly encourage IPCSA-backed attendance at the 2007 NAPSA Conference in Cleveland, Ohio for two Committee representatives (see attached letter).
  1. Continue to work on developing and refining the Committee Newsletter.  Mechanisms for the ongoing publication and distribution of the newsletter will be reviewed.
  1. Examine the findings obtained from the 2006 Pretrial Services Survey, including the identification of training needs, program development issues, and compliance with the Illinois Pretrial Services Act, AOIC Pretrial Procedural Standards and suggested NAPSA Standards.
  1. Maintain a working relationship with AOIC by encouraging participation by an AOIC representative with Committee projects and meetings.

The Committee usually will meet at least four times per year: at the Fall and Spring IPCSA Conferences and at summer and winter meetings at Illinois State University, Normal, IL.  2006 meetings were consistent with this schedule.
